Skip to content

Software frame encoder using CUDA and cast encoded frames over UDP. Trying to implement a custom streaming protocol and shader based frame encoder/decoder for screencast.

Notifications You must be signed in to change notification settings

TLabAltoh/tlab-sharescreen-server-win

Repository files navigation

tlab-sharescreen-server-win

Software frame encoder using CUDA and cast encoded frames over UDP. Trying to implement a custom streaming protocol and shader based frame encoder/decoder for screencast.

Warning

This is an experimental project and is only a degraded version of MPEG. Currently not intended for practical use. I hope you take it as an example of video streaming via custom protocol and software encoder/decoder.

Screenshot (with use of tlab-sharescreen-client-unity)

localhost (127.0.0.1)

TLabShareScreen_Wireless_Android.mp4

Android Device

DSC_0002

Operating Environment

Property Value
OS Windows 10 Pro
GPU NVIDIA GeForce RTX 3070
CUDA 11.8

Client Software

About

Software frame encoder using CUDA and cast encoded frames over UDP. Trying to implement a custom streaming protocol and shader based frame encoder/decoder for screencast.

Topics

Resources

Stars

Watchers

Forks

Packages

No packages published